Hyperpolygons and Hitchin systems

Published 23 Oct 2014 in math.AG and math.SG | (1410.6467v1)

Abstract: We study the hyperk\"ahler analogues of moduli spaces of semistable n-gons in complex projective space. We prove that the hyperk\"ahler Kirwan map is surjective and produce a formula that recursively calculates the Betti numbers of these spaces for all ranks. Building on a natural analogy between hyperpolygons and parabolic Higgs bundles, we identify hyperpolygon spaces with certain degenerate Hitchin systems, and use this to establish their complete integrability, for ranks up to and including 3.
